I noticed 3 days ago now that one of my week old pygmy chams had one of its eyes shut. It's been three days now and the poor guy still isn't opening his eye and now his tongue aim is off. I can see him still moving it around and such but the actual eyeball itself will not open.
I need some advice from someone knowledgeable in pygmies on what to do. I didnt know if maybe misting him with warm water to loosen it up might help? Or if it's safe to do on such a small cham. The eye is not sunken in at all and it does not look crusty in any form.
I was also wondering if that didn't work if it is SAFE to buy turtle eye drops and put it on a q-tip and slightly dab the eye with it? Is is harmful to use turtle drops on such a young tiny chameleon? I hope someone can help me out with this. Thanks!
